The facts are simple: Biological tissue is stimulated by alternating current. If you want reproducible results, you have to be able to reliably control the amplitude and time course of this current. If you want to minimize damage to the tissue and the electrode and control electrical artifact. you have to deliver both phases of the alternating current quickly and symmetrically.
